    • @DutchBushcraftKnives
      @DutchBushcraftKnives  7 лет назад

      Mikkie make your own comment!
      Maarten here: My favourite knife would have to be a draw between the Bark river Aurora and the Fallkniven A1 Pro. The bark river aurora is just such a versatile knife. complimented with the CPM-3V steel and amazing handle geometry it makes one of the most satisfying knives to work with. The A1 pro has the CoS steel which is just amazingly well balanced. I might use the F1 pro more often but I just love batonning and the regular a1 was my first real quality knife so i have nostalgic feelings towards the A1. I also love fallknivens simplicity and how care-free they are. They are real users.
